CCSE to continue for 4th year as admin of California clean vehicle rebate program; $59.55M for current fiscal year

Green Car Congress

Future funding is expected thanks to the recently authorized AB 8 ( earlier post ) that guarantees the state’s current clean vehicle and alternative fuel incentive initiatives continue through 2023 with a budget in excess of $2 billion. Since the CVRP launched in 2010, it has awarded more than $60 million for 33,000 vehicle rebates.

Honda to launch electric-two wheelers in India by 2024

Electric Vehicles India

Honda Motorcycle and Scooter India (HMSI) has announced its plans to launch electric two-wheelers in India next year. Next year, Honda will introduce two electric scooters in India, one of which will be an upgraded Activa. Honda aims to provide 10 electric scooters in its lineup over the next five years.
